c255baf675 
								
							 
						 
						
							
							
								
								style fix: no ?> at the end of file  
							
							
							
						 
						
							2008-04-27 03:45:57 +00:00  
				
					
						
							
							
								 
						
							
								f4cf4d77dd 
								
							 
						 
						
							
							
								
								style fix: no ?> at the end of file  
							
							
							
						 
						
							2008-04-27 03:45:30 +00:00  
				
					
						
							
							
								 
						
							
								73a1b432f8 
								
							 
						 
						
							
							
								
								usability fixes:  
							
							... 
							
							
							
							* remove the redundant "MySQL" in "MySQL users"
 * move that "Users" menu lower down to make it obvious "MySQL" is all about "Databases" 
							
						 
						
							2008-04-27 03:42:56 +00:00  
				
					
						
							
							
								 
						
							
								f06159603b 
								
							 
						 
						
							
							
								
								usability fix: put the logout button all the way at the bottom instead of somewhere near the bottom  
							
							
							
						 
						
							2008-04-27 03:38:34 +00:00  
				
					
						
							
							
								 
						
							
								5611cae418 
								
							 
						 
						
							
							
								
								rename a few options in the main admin menu:  
							
							... 
							
							
							
							* the menu is now named "Administration" (instead of "Reseller")
 * "Admin Control Panel" is now renamed "AlternC configuration" 
							
						 
						
							2008-04-27 03:35:05 +00:00  
				
					
						
							
							
								 
						
							
								93c9152aab 
								
							 
						 
						
							
							
								
								whitespace style fix  
							
							
							
						 
						
							2008-04-27 03:27:33 +00:00  
				
					
						
							
							
								 
						
							
								50567f1edd 
								
							 
						 
						
							
							
								
								make a real "Web statistics" section, independent of the raw web stats  
							
							... 
							
							
							
							quotas and al 
							
						 
						
							2008-04-27 03:25:54 +00:00  
				
					
						
							
							
								 
						
							
								ddab3792e8 
								
							 
						 
						
							
							
								
								fix menu style  
							
							
							
						 
						
							2008-04-24 23:03:20 +00:00  
				
					
						
							
							
								 
						
							
								a2f598a593 
								
							 
						 
						
							
							
								
								correct usage of array_unshift  
							
							
							
						 
						
							2008-04-24 18:23:55 +00:00  
				
					
						
							
							
								 
						
							
								a843e1200d 
								
							 
						 
						
							
							
								
								partially revert last change: stick to printf, but still allow  
							
							... 
							
							
							
							variable number of arguments in error handlers
we don't want to switch to strtr as ->raise() is used everywhere
without arrays... 
							
						 
						
							2008-04-24 18:17:43 +00:00  
				
					
						
							
							
								 
						
							
								fc9c612c21 
								
							 
						 
						
							
							
								
								use strtr instead of printf to expand variables in translated strings  
							
							... 
							
							
							
							this means that the error arguments are now passed as an associative
array.
exemple:
$err->raise("foo", "error message: %error", array('%error' => "blah")); 
							
						 
						
							2008-04-24 18:07:11 +00:00  
				
					
						
							
							
								 
						
							
								15f9312e72 
								
							 
						 
						
							
							
								
								doc update of error handler  
							
							
							
						 
						
							2008-04-24 17:56:04 +00:00  
				
					
						
							
							
								 
						
							
								4f795a092c 
								
							 
						 
						
							
							
								
								lien vers la documentation utilisateur au lieu de la documentation generale  
							
							
							
						 
						
							2008-04-14 19:42:14 +00:00  
				
					
						
							
							
								 
						
							
								172adf7a3d 
								
							 
						 
						
							
							
								
								language switcher in the main interface  
							
							
							
						 
						
							2008-04-14 19:41:24 +00:00  
				
					
						
							
							
								 
						
							
								ea996efb27 
								
							 
						 
						
							
							
								
								move messages with settings, renamed 'Other'  
							
							
							
						 
						
							2008-04-14 19:18:35 +00:00  
				
					
						
							
							
								 
						
							
								d2b8570f14 
								
							 
						 
						
							
							
								
								make 'Reseller' translatable  
							
							
							
						 
						
							2008-04-14 19:16:36 +00:00  
				
					
						
							
							
								 
						
							
								25c072227c 
								
							 
						 
						
							
							
								
								link to the wiki for documentation  
							
							
							
						 
						
							2008-04-14 19:13:18 +00:00  
				
					
						
							
							
								 
						
							
								a76565250a 
								
							 
						 
						
							
							
								
								group together more menus, rename the meaningless Frontpage menu into Messages  
							
							
							
						 
						
							2008-04-14 19:10:43 +00:00  
				
					
						
							
							
								 
						
							
								2058e1e1a5 
								
							 
						 
						
							
							
								
								group protected folders and FTP accounts with the file browser, under a category named 'Files and directories'  
							
							
							
						 
						
							2008-04-14 19:00:30 +00:00  
				
					
						
							
							
								 
						
							
								35510e3d6a 
								
							 
						 
						
							
							
								
								remove developpment warning that crept into 0.9.8  
							
							
							
						 
						
							2008-04-14 18:58:53 +00:00  
				
					
						
							
							
								 
						
							
								d85ced9da1 
								
							 
						 
						
							
							
								
								another last minute fix: fix parse error in timing display  
							
							
							
						 
						
							2008-04-14 03:42:42 +00:00  
				
					
						
							
							
								 
						
							
								47958a8922 
								
							 
						 
						
							
							
								
								fix a few style issues, mainly with the buttons, FTP accounts and  
							
							... 
							
							
							
							Mailbox displays.
Contributed by: Marc Angles
Sponsored by: Koumbit 
							
						 
						
							2008-04-13 05:04:41 +00:00  
				
					
						
							
							
								 
						
							
								d5a4c72e4a 
								
							 
						 
						
							
							
								
								Major redesign of the MySQL backend interface to fix a security issue.  
							
							... 
							
							
							
							See: #318 .
As of now, the MySQL configuration used everywhere by AlternC is not
stored in the main configuration file (/etc/alternc/local.sh) but in a
MySQL configuration file in /etc/alternc/my.cnf, which enables us to
call mysql without exposing the password on the commandline.
The changes here are quite invasive but will allow us to factor out
the MySQL configuration better. See #364 .
This includes a partial rewrite of the mysql.sh logic, which is now ran
from the postinst script (and not alternc.install) which will allow us
to actually change the MySQL root user properly. See #601 .
This commit was tested like this:
 * clean install on etch (working)
 * upgrade from a clean 0.9.7 (working) 
							
						 
						
							2008-04-13 04:35:19 +00:00  
				
					
						
							
							
								 
						
							
								7e3fcdf646 
								
							 
						 
						
							
							
								
								regenerate locales to give translators a chance to translate 0.9.8  
							
							... 
							
							
							
							NEW MESSAGES TO TRANSLATE
regenerer les locales pour que les traducteurs/trices puissent traduire
0.9.8
NOUVEAUX MESSAGES À TRADUIRE 
							
						 
						
							2008-04-12 22:41:48 +00:00  
				
					
						
							
							
								 
						
							
								131b6a7f5e 
								
							 
						 
						
							
							
								
								cosmetic change: better alignment in variable decl.  
							
							
							
						 
						
							2008-04-12 21:07:16 +00:00  
				
					
						
							
							
								 
						
							
								ee87f3bbb8 
								
							 
						 
						
							
							
								
								fix indentation  
							
							
							
						 
						
							2008-04-12 20:01:07 +00:00  
				
					
						
							
							
								 
						
							
								d0e9dc8d59 
								
							 
						 
						
							
							
								
								tell the user at which time the changes will be effective instead of the  
							
							... 
							
							
							
							vague "5 minutes".
Sponsored by: Koumbit
Closes : #231  
							
						 
						
							2008-04-11 01:01:59 +00:00  
				
					
						
							
							
								 
						
							
								0e29de73eb 
								
							 
						 
						
							
							
								
								integrate patch for linking to domains directly in domain listing.  
							
							... 
							
							
							
							Patch from: Sebastien Grenier
Closes : #1097  
							
						 
						
							2008-04-10 20:05:19 +00:00  
				
					
						
							
							
								 
						
							
								c8f477c3ec 
								
							 
						 
						
							
							
								
								crude implementation of permission change in the file browser  
							
							... 
							
							
							
							Contributed by: Mathieu Lutfy
Sponsored by: Koumbit 
							
						 
						
							2008-04-10 18:40:08 +00:00  
				
					
						
							
							
								 
						
							
								9517d27d78 
								
							 
						 
						
							
							
								
								Standardisation de l'interface web d'AlternC, qui passe maintenant la  
							
							... 
							
							
							
							validation du w3c
Refonte de certains styles et couleurs, tel que discuté sur la liste de
discussion.
Des modifications locales peuvent maintenant être faites dans
styles/custom.css qui n'est pas distribué avec AlternC et donc jamais
remplacé.
Contribution de Marc Angles
Sponsorisé par Koumbit 
							
						 
						
							2008-04-10 18:05:51 +00:00  
				
					
						
							
							
								 
						
							
								aad2d5ef0d 
								
							 
						 
						
							
							
								
								silence various warnings with rss feed functionality  
							
							... 
							
							
							
							i did not add configuration directives as requested, as it would annoy
people that don't *want* to install the rss functionality.
Closes : #1099  
							
						 
						
							2008-03-14 04:11:07 +00:00  
				
					
						
							
							
								 
						
							
								8f8c888abd 
								
							 
						 
						
							
							
								
								get rid of the non-working Send & extract button  
							
							
							
						 
						
							2008-03-14 04:03:12 +00:00  
				
					
						
							
							
								 
						
							
								c192607d51 
								
							 
						 
						
							
							
								
								fix archive extraction:  
							
							... 
							
							
							
							* call with the proper path
* remove the quotes from the calls, they're already there
* make ExtractFile non-recursive
* force unzip extraction to overwrite existing files 
							
						 
						
							2008-03-14 03:08:14 +00:00  
				
					
						
							
							
								 
						
							
								cb1c8276f7 
								
							 
						 
						
							
							
								
								add date, remove cruft  
							
							
							
						 
						
							2008-02-27 05:23:21 +00:00  
				
					
						
							
							
								 
						
							
								e8caebb01f 
								
							 
						 
						
							
							
								
								add trivial code to display an RSS feed on the home page of users, feed can be changed in the variables panel  
							
							
							
						 
						
							2008-02-01 23:03:53 +00:00  
				
					
						
							
							
								 
						
							
								2fc2361877 
								
							 
						 
						
							
							
								
								remove debug message  
							
							
							
						 
						
							2008-01-22 04:20:39 +00:00  
				
					
						
							
							
								 
						
							
								c6612a3092 
								
							 
						 
						
							
							
								
								hook in the extract action.  
							
							... 
							
							
							
							Closes : #1043  
						
							2008-01-22 04:14:20 +00:00  
				
					
						
							
							
								 
						
							
								eaefa56fb9 
								
							 
						 
						
							
							
								
								improve error handling in extraction code, add is_extractable functionality  
							
							
							
						 
						
							2008-01-22 04:12:24 +00:00  
				
					
						
							
							
								 
						
							
								de54a15ca0 
								
							 
						 
						
							
							
								
								more factorization in error messages: make errstr() work with our new messaging system  
							
							
							
						 
						
							2008-01-22 04:11:00 +00:00  
				
					
						
							
							
								 
						
							
								d63da16fcc 
								
							 
						 
						
							
							
								
								don't translate mimetypes in m_bro::mime(). revert hooking tarball extraction from the last commit  
							
							
							
						 
						
							2008-01-22 03:39:01 +00:00  
				
					
						
							
							
								 
						
							
								6b07f7f68b 
								
							 
						 
						
							
							
								
								try to hook extraction in the browser  
							
							
							
						 
						
							2008-01-22 03:23:56 +00:00  
				
					
						
							
							
								 
						
							
								97d65aadb3 
								
							 
						 
						
							
							
								
								make UploadFile() return the uploaded path  
							
							... 
							
							
							
							make ExtractFile extract in the same directory as the archive by default 
							
						 
						
							2008-01-22 03:23:26 +00:00  
				
					
						
							
							
								 
						
							
								7ecbf6d263 
								
							 
						 
						
							
							
								
								use move_uploaded_file to get uploaded files instead of copy (svn diff), as recommended in the php manual, see  http://php.net/move_uploaded_file  
							
							
							
						 
						
							2008-01-22 03:13:54 +00:00  
				
					
						
							
							
								 
						
							
								ca5137fc7b 
								
							 
						 
						
							
							
								
								reorder CopyFile API so that it works like MoveFile (ie. support multiple files  
							
							
							
						 
						
							2008-01-22 03:08:10 +00:00  
				
					
						
							
							
								 
						
							
								e47e12df88 
								
							 
						 
						
							
							
								
								reorder copy button  
							
							
							
						 
						
							2008-01-22 03:06:45 +00:00  
				
					
						
							
							
								 
						
							
								0a65fa34b9 
								
							 
						 
						
							
							
								
								try to hook the new CopyFile function into the main brouteur  
							
							
							
						 
						
							2008-01-22 02:41:33 +00:00  
				
					
						
							
							
								 
						
							
								57cf564a80 
								
							 
						 
						
							
							
								
								remove recursive mkdir code  
							
							... 
							
							
							
							place the escapeshellarg() calls properly
print the cp error on failure
assume the target parent directory 
							
						 
						
							2008-01-22 02:30:23 +00:00  
				
					
						
							
							
								 
						
							
								ed74b4debc 
								
							 
						 
						
							
							
								
								remove write tests: cp will fail all by itself, no need to test  
							
							
							
						 
						
							2008-01-22 02:27:22 +00:00  
				
					
						
							
							
								 
						
							
								48871eb7d4 
								
							 
						 
						
							
							
								
								use escapeshellarg() properly and in both functions.  
							
							
							
						 
						
							2008-01-22 02:24:59 +00:00  
				
					
						
							
							
								 
						
							
								3de628ccb2 
								
							 
						 
						
							
							
								
								adaptation du code de copie de fichier:  
							
							... 
							
							
							
							* desactiver le code de copie par http:// pour l'instant
 * utilise escapeshellarg() au lieu de addslashes() pour echapper les arguments
 * utiliser le bon systeme de message d'erreurs
 * ajouter -p a l'appel de cp 
							
						 
						
							2008-01-22 02:19:54 +00:00